Medicine Iontophoresis Instrument Market Trends and Forecast
The future of the global medicine iontophoresis instrument market looks promising with opportunities in the home, commercial, and hospital markets. The global medicine iontophoresis instrument market is expected to grow with a CAGR of 3.5% from 2025 to 2031. The major drivers for this market are the rising demand for non-invasive treatments, the growing prevalence of chronic conditions, and the growing awareness about treatment options.
• Lucintel forecasts that, within the type category, low frequency will remain the largest segment over the forecast period due to broad consumer adoption for treating conditions like hyperhidrosis, dermatological issues.
• Within the application category, home will remain the largest segment due to increasing popularity of self-care and at-home treatment options.
• In terms of region, North America will remain the largest region over the forecast period due to high healthcare expenditure, consumer awareness, and widespread adoption.

Emerging Trends in the Medicine Iontophoresis Instrument Market
The medicine Iontophoresis instrument market is evolving with new technologies, increased adoption across clinical and consumer applications, and shifting patient preferences. These emerging trends are reshaping the market, making iontophoresis a viable alternative to traditional drug delivery methods.
• Non-Invasive Drug Delivery: Iontophoresis is increasingly preferred for its non-invasive nature, providing an alternative to needles and injections. Patients, especially those managing chronic conditions, find non-invasive methods more convenient and less painful. The ability to deliver drugs directly through the skin without the need for invasive procedures is driving greater adoption in both clinical settings and at-home care, contributing to market growth.
• Home-Use Devices: There is a growing trend towards home-use iontophoresis devices, enabling patients to manage conditions like hyperhidrosis and chronic pain at home. These devices offer convenience and privacy, reducing the need for frequent visits to healthcare providers. The market is responding to consumer demand for affordable and easy-to-use therapeutic devices, leading to increased competition and innovation in design and functionality.
• Customization and Personalization: Advances in technology are enabling more personalized treatment options. Devices are becoming more customizable, allowing users to adjust parameters like current intensity and duration for optimal drug delivery. Personalization enhances the efficacy and comfort of treatments, making iontophoresis devices more appealing to a broader range of patients, especially those seeking tailored solutions for chronic conditions.
• Integration with Digital Health: Many modern iontophoresis devices are incorporating digital health features, such as app connectivity for tracking treatment progress. These integrations allow users to monitor their treatment regimen and communicate with healthcare providers remotely. This trend is fostering the development of connected health solutions, providing patients with more control over their therapy and improving compliance and outcomes.
• Rising Demand in Emerging Markets: As healthcare infrastructure improves in emerging markets, the demand for iontophoresis instruments is increasing. Countries like India and China are embracing non-invasive treatments, driven by the need for cost-effective, easily accessible healthcare solutions. This trend is expanding the market beyond traditional Western regions, presenting significant growth opportunities for iontophoresis device manufacturers.
These emerging trends in the medicine Iontophoresis instrument market are reshaping how drug delivery is perceived and adopted. As non-invasive treatments gain popularity and technological advancements continue, the market is becoming more competitive, with a broader range of applications and improved user experience. The integration of digital health, personalized treatments, and expanding market access will contribute to the continued growth of the iontophoresis market.

Medicine Iontophoresis Instrument Market Driver and Challenges
The medicine Iontophoresis instrument market is influenced by several drivers and challenges, including technological advancements, economic factors, and regulatory hurdles. Understanding these factors is key to navigating the market’s growth and potential obstacles.
The factors responsible for driving the medicine Iontophoresis instrument market include:
1. Technological Advancements: The development of more efficient, compact, and user-friendly iontophoresis devices is a key driver of market growth. Enhanced drug delivery mechanisms, improved patient comfort, and the integration of digital health features are all contributing to the wider adoption of these devices.
2. Increased Demand for Non-Invasive Treatments: Patients’ preference for non-invasive treatments is driving the adoption of iontophoresis. As chronic disease management becomes more focused on non-invasive solutions, iontophoresis devices offer a viable alternative to injections and other traditional therapies.
3. Aging Population: The growing global aging population is increasing the demand for healthcare solutions that are easy to use and require less maintenance. Iontophoresis devices are particularly suited for elderly patients who need regular medication but wish to avoid the discomfort of needles or hospital visits.
4. Regulatory Approvals: The approval of iontophoresis devices by regulatory bodies like the FDA has opened up new markets for manufacturers. Regulatory support helps to assure patients and healthcare providers of the safety and efficacy of these devices, leading to wider adoption.
5. Healthcare Cost Pressures: Rising healthcare costs are pushing patients and healthcare providers to seek more affordable solutions. Iontophoresis devices, which can often be used at home, help reduce the need for costly hospital visits, making them an appealing option in cost-sensitive markets.
Challenges in the medicine Iontophoresis instrument market are:
1. High Initial Costs: Despite their long-term affordability, the high initial cost of iontophoresis devices can be a barrier for many patients, particularly in developing markets. Manufacturers need to address pricing concerns to ensure wider adoption.
2. Regulatory Hurdles: While regulatory approvals have been a driver, navigating the complex regulatory landscape in different regions can still pose challenges. Stricter regulations in certain countries may delay product launches or limit market access.
3. Limited Awareness: There is still limited awareness of iontophoresis devices among some patient populations and healthcare providers. Educational initiatives and awareness campaigns are necessary to overcome this challenge and promote the benefits of iontophoresis.
The medicine Iontophoresis instrument market is shaped by several key drivers, including technological advancements, rising demand for non-invasive treatments, and regulatory approvals. However, challenges such as high initial costs, regulatory hurdles, and limited awareness remain significant barriers. Overcoming these challenges while leveraging the market drivers will be crucial for the continued growth and success of the iontophoresis device market.

Country Wise Outlook for the Medicine Iontophoresis Instrument Market
The medicine Iontophoresis instrument market is experiencing significant growth due to advancements in healthcare technology, patient demand for non-invasive treatments, and a focus on chronic disease management. The key countries driving innovation and adoption include the United States, China, Germany, India, and Japan, each exhibiting unique trends and progress in their respective markets. These advancements are driven by technological developments, regulatory changes, and increasing awareness about the benefits of iontophoresis in drug delivery.
• United States: In the United States, the market for medicine iontophoresis instruments has expanded due to the rise in demand for non-invasive drug delivery methods. The FDA’s approval of advanced iontophoresis devices has opened new avenues in healthcare, particularly for treating conditions like hyperhidrosis and chronic pain. Additionally, increasing healthcare spending and a growing aging population are accelerating the demand for such devices, with significant investment in research and development by major medical device manufacturers.
• China: China is rapidly adopting iontophoresis technology, primarily driven by the growing healthcare needs of its vast population. The market has seen growth in electrotherapy devices, which include iontophoresis instruments used in various therapeutic applications. With government support for innovative medical technologies and increasing healthcare investments, China is focusing on integrating advanced drug delivery systems into its medical infrastructure, creating more opportunities for iontophoresis devices in both the consumer and clinical sectors.
• Germany: Germany, a leader in medical technology, has witnessed substantial progress in the iontophoresis instrument market, particularly with the rise of advanced home-use devices. Innovations in design and technology have led to more compact, efficient, and user-friendly iontophoresis systems. Germany’s regulatory framework supports the integration of these devices into clinical practice, and increased acceptance of non-invasive treatments for dermatological and musculoskeletal conditions is driving growth. Companies are also focusing on enhancing the precision of drug delivery via iontophoresis.
• India: India’s medical device market, including iontophoresis instruments, is on an upward trajectory due to increasing healthcare needs, a large diabetic population, and a preference for cost-effective, non-invasive treatments. The government’s push to modernize the healthcare system, along with rising disposable incomes, has contributed to the growth of iontophoresis devices. Although the market is still emerging, the acceptance of iontophoresis for pain management and dermatological conditions is expected to grow in the coming years.
• Japan: Japan’s mature healthcare market is witnessing steady adoption of iontophoresis technology. With an aging population and an increasing demand for non-invasive treatment options, the country has seen advancements in both clinical and home-use iontophoresis devices. Japanese consumers are becoming more health-conscious, leading to growing demand for devices that offer a safe, effective, and non-invasive alternative to traditional drug administration methods. The market is expected to continue growing as Japan further integrates advanced medical technologies into its healthcare system.
